Paperless Parts - About the company

Paperless Parts is a series B company based in Boston (United States), founded in 2017 by Matthew Sordillo, Jason & Ray and Scott Sawyer. It operates as a Provider of cost estimation and quoting software for the manufacturing industry. Paperless Parts has raised $45.5M in funding from OpenView. The company has 42 active competitors, including 6 that are funded. Its top competitors include companies like 3D Spark, DigiFabster and Muir.

Company Details

Provider of cost estimation and quoting software for the manufacturing industry. The cloud-based estimation and quoting software is used to manage and streamline operations, improve customer service and grow the business. Features include CRM, an intelligent configure price quote system, secure file sharing, integrated quote performance analytics, and comprehensive reporting
